LT Profits

Chicago Cubs -125

Carlos Zambrano of the Chicago Cubs and Derek Lowe of the Los Angeles Dodgers are both in fine form, but Lowe is the more likely of the two to implode at a moment’s notice.

Yes, Lowe has a 1.23 ERA and 0.86 WHIP in his last three starts, but consistency has never been a strong suit for him and has had four consecutive poor starts prior to this hot stretch. Lowe has always been a bit fragile on the mound when things are not going his way, and you simply never know which pitcher is going to show up.

On the other hand, Zambrano has been more consistent, posting eight Quality Starts in his 10 outings, allowing three runs but going only five innings in one of the other starts and allowing four runs in the last one. Perhaps most importantly, he has pitched exceptionally well at Dodger Stadium, allowing grand total of three earned runs and 15 hits over 29.2 innings in his last four starts here.

The Dodgers quieted the hot Cubs bats in a 3-0 LA win last night, but look for Chicago to rebound nicely tonight.

Pick: Cubs -125

Philadelphia Phillies +105

The Philadelphia Phillies rallied for a 10-inning win over the Atlanta Braves here last night after tying the game in the ninth inning, and we look for the Phillies to win their second straight game in this series tonight.

Sure, the Braves are an incredible 25-9 at home, but two of those losses have come in the last three games with the bullpen faltering in the ninth inning on both occasions. Atlanta starter Jo-Jo Reyes was not treated kindly in his only other start vs. Philadelphia this season, as he was lit up for five earned runs and 11 hits in 6.2 innings. Given the performance of what had previously been a good bullpen lately, a similar performance here would almost certainly mean defeat.

Now Kyle Kendrick has five Quality Starts in his last seven outings, excluding one start vs. Toronto where he was pulled after the first inning due to a long rain delay. More importantly, he has allowed three runs or less in all three of his starts vs. Atlanta since the start of last year, including a Quality Start this season in Philadelphia last month. Also, unlike the Atlanta bullpen, the Phillies are showing no signs of regression, in fact leading the Major Leagues with a 2.69 pen ERA.

Do not forget also that the Phillies have been just as hot as the more highly publicized Chicago Cubs lately, as Philadelphia is 10-2 in their last 12 games, and we look for them to expand on that today.

Pick: Phillies +105
